From 40d8ae711ac1e21168841af2147ef9e9d4c7980d Mon Sep 17 00:00:00 2001 From: "Gustavo L de Mello (Guz)" Date: Fri, 10 Jan 2025 11:42:07 -0300 Subject: [PATCH] feat(blogo,renderers): fallback default renderer --- blogo/blogo.go |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/blogo/blogo.go b/blogo/blogo.go index f6eb6f7..ebea7b6 100644 --- a/blogo/blogo.go +++ b/blogo/blogo.go @@ -141,10 +141,10 @@ func (b *Blogo) Init() error { log.Debug("No SourcerPlugin found, using default one") b.Use(&defaultSourcer{}) } - if len(b.renderers) == 0 { - log.Debug("No RendererPlugin found, using default one") - b.Use(&defaultRenderer{}) - } + + renderer := &defaultRenderer{} + log.Debug(fmt.Sprintf("Adding %q as fallback renderer", renderer.Name())) + b.Use(&defaultRenderer{}) fs, err := b.sources[0].Source() // TOOD: Support for multiple sources (via another plugin or built-in, with prefixes or not) if err != nil {